Abstract: In this paper, an intelligent energy management is presented for distributed structure such as a smart microgrid (MG) that can operate in islanded or connected mode with the main grid. To model this MG, a multi-agent is proposed. This system is based on wind power prediction and fuzzy logic control for storage device. The goal of the MAS is to control the amount of power delivered or taken from the main grid in order to reduce the cost and maximise the benefit, to achieve the mentioned goal, the neural network is proposed to predict the amount of electricity that will be produced for the next hour and fuzzy logic control for the battery to taking a reasonable decision about storing or selling electricity, finally and for the simulation, the jade platform has been used to show the impact of using the proposed system.
